The Most Affordable Cities For Students in Colorado
1. Fort Collins
Located in northern Colorado, Fort Collins is a popular choice for students due to its affordable cost of living and excellent educational institutions.
The city is home to Colorado State University, which offers a wide range of academic programs. With a thriving arts and culture scene, diverse dining options, and numerous outdoor recreational activities, Fort Collins provides an ideal environment for students to thrive.
2. Greeley
Greeley, situated just east of the Rocky Mountains, is another affordable city for students in Colorado. The University of Northern Colorado, a renowned institution, attracts a large student population, making it a vibrant and youthful community.
Greeley offers affordable housing options, a lower cost of living compared to other cities in the state, and an array of entertainment choices.
3. Pueblo
Located in southern Colorado, Pueblo is a small city with a low cost of living, making it an attractive option for students seeking affordability.
Pueblo Community College and Colorado State University-Pueblo provide quality education opportunities. With its rich history, vibrant arts scene, and access to outdoor activities, Pueblo offers a well-rounded experience for students.
4. Colorado Springs
Known for its stunning natural beauty and proximity to the majestic Pikes Peak, Colorado Springs is not only an attractive tourist destination but also an affordable city for students.
The city is home to the University of Colorado Colorado Springs and several other institutions. Students can enjoy a low cost of living, various recreational activities, and a thriving job market in Colorado Springs.
5. Grand Junction
Situated in western Colorado, Grand Junction offers a unique blend of affordability, natural beauty, and outdoor recreational opportunities. Colorado Mesa University attracts students from all over the state and beyond, offering a wide range of academic programs.
The city’s lower cost of living, beautiful scenery, and proximity to hiking, biking, and skiing destinations make it an excellent choice for students seeking an affordable and adventurous college experience.
6. Durango
Nestled in the scenic Animas River Valley, Durango is a charming and affordable city in southwestern Colorado. Home to Fort Lewis College, Durango offers a welcoming community, a rich cultural heritage, and a low cost of living.
Students can enjoy exploring the nearby San Juan Mountains, engaging in outdoor activities, and experiencing the vibrant downtown area.
7. Alamosa
Alamosa, located in the San Luis Valley of southern Colorado, is a small and affordable city that offers a unique cultural experience. Adams State University, known for its education and business programs, attracts students to the area.
The city’s low cost of living, breathtaking mountain views, and access to outdoor adventures make Alamosa an ideal place for students seeking affordability and a close-knit community.
8. Gunnison
Gunnison, nestled in the heart of the Colorado Rockies, is a picturesque city that blends affordability and natural beauty. Home to Western Colorado University, students can enjoy a variety of academic programs while surrounded by stunning mountain landscapes.
The city offers a lower cost of living compared to other mountain towns, making it an attractive option for students seeking an affordable education in a breathtaking setting.
9. Trinidad
Trinidad, located in southern Colorado near the New Mexico border, provides an affordable living environment for students. Trinidad State Junior College is a notable institution that offers a range of associate degree programs.
The city’s historic downtown, outdoor recreational opportunities, and affordable housing options make Trinidad an appealing choice for students.
10. Lamar
Lamar, located in southeastern Colorado, offers an affordable cost of living and a close-knit community feel. Lamar Community College provides various academic programs, attracting students who prefer smaller class sizes and personalized attention.
With its small-town charm, numerous parks, and low crime rate, Lamar is an excellent choice for students seeking affordability and a tight-knit community atmosphere.
